When users report broken dark-mode rendering in the Ostrell admin dashboard, check that the theme service is reachable before escalating. The dashboard fetches palette tokens from the Ostrell theme API at login; a timeout falls back to light mode silently. To reproduce locally, set `OSTRELL_THEME=dark` in `.env`, then add the theme API credential on the next line:

vault entry, yahif-yajep: COURIER_KEY29=b802bdf8034096b65a51c6ba5abe2

Subject: DR Drill — Canary Gating Rules Walkthrough

Hello,

Ahead of Thursday's disaster-recovery drill, here is the context you requested as security reviewer. During the drill we will simulate a failed canary on the Marrowbank deploy pipeline: gating rules halt promotion if error rate exceeds 0.5% or latency p99 doubles against baseline. Overriding a halted gate during the drill requires the break-glass flow, including the recovery passphrase, which I am including below for your verification.

Regards,
Dorit

recovery phrase for bawep-yadug: druael-tamion-gilion

## Runbook: Proseprobe doc linter

Welcome aboard! Proseprobe lints our docs repo on every merge and yells about passive voice, broken anchors, and stale screenshots. To run it locally: clone the docs repo, install deps with `make setup`, then `make lint`. Most failures are self-explanatory; anchor errors usually mean a heading got renamed. Locally the linter also checks our style-guide service, which requires auth, so open your env file and add the service credential on the next line.

sealed setting: VAULT_KEY20=c8ea1e419912889df6b4

// Compaction window for the Quillbus message queue.
// Segments older than this threshold are merged and dead-lettered keys
// are dropped permanently, so changing it mid-release can orphan consumers
// that replay from compacted offsets. Release managers: coordinate any
// adjustment with the Fernwake retention review, and never lower this
// value while a compaction pass is in flight, since partial merges leave
// tombstones that inflate disk usage until the next full sweep.
// The value was last validated against the build recorded here.

pipeline stamp: htk31_f769b577b3028a4e9958e5bb8d1259a